Spiš Castle (Spišský hrad), Slovakia
Aug 17, 2009 #27 on Explore and o Front Page
"Spiš Castle with its area of more than four ha, and partially in ruins, is one of the largest castle compounds in Central Europe. Spiš Castle was included in the UNESCO list of monuments belonging to the world cultural heritage in 1993.
Construction of the medieval castle on a travertine hill dates back to the beginning of the 12th century."
